The History of Dairy in Tibet

Researchers in Poland have found evidence that late Neolithic peoples were making cheese from the milk of several different animals as long ago as sixth millennium BCE. This may help explain why there's so much evidence of people consuming milk during a time when virtually all adults were lactose intolerant. In our last little bit of dairy news, Chinese scientists have found evidence of milk being consumed and stored in Tibet as long as 3000 years ago.
